C'était trop beau !
Ca eût fonctionné et puis la cata !
Il se passe ceci (suite à ces erreurs, je me suis rendu compte que le champ last_date n'existait pas ; pourtant, j'ai réussi à un moment à afficher mes images même si en admin je n'avais pas le treeview) :
Si phpwg_user_cache_categories.date_last n'existe pas, j'ai ce message au moment où je change d'utilisateur
Warning: [mysql error 1054] Unknown column 'date_last' in 'field list'
INSERT INTO phpwg_user_cache_categories
(user_id,cat_id,date_last,max_date_last,nb_images,count_images,count_categories)
VALUES('1','84','2006-01-01 00:00:00','2006-01-01 00:00:00','116','116','0')
, ('1','119','2008-01-03 00:00:00','2008-01-03 00:00:00','20','20','0')
, ('1','164','2009-07-19 23:47:11','2009-07-19 23:47:11','432','432','0')
, ('1','113','2007-07-28 00:00:00','2007-07-28 00:00:00','206','206','0')
, ('1','136',NULL,'2008-08-26 22:10:14','0','552','5')
, ('1','137','2008-08-25 21:44:36','2008-08-25 21:44:36','127','127','0')
, ('1','138','2008-08-26 22:10:14','2008-08-26 22:10:14','35','35','0')
, ('1','139','2008-08-25 21:45:41','2008-08-25 21:45:41','94','94','0')
, ('1','140','2008-08-26 06:44:56','2008-08-26 06:44:56','227','227','0')
, ('1','141','2008-08-26 22:10:14','2008-08-26 22:10:14','69','69','0')
, ('1','74','2005-11-13 00:00:00','2005-11-13 00:00:00','166','257','1')
, ('1','75','2005-11-13 0 in /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/functions.inc.php on line 918
Warning: Cannot modify header information - headers already sent by (output started at /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/functions.inc.php:917) in /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/page_header.php on line 98
Je réussi tout de même à me connecter en tant qu'admin et à configurer ma galerie.
Si je crée dans la table le champ correspondant, j'ai ce message au démarrage
Warning: [mysql error 1052] Column 'date_last' in field list is ambiguous
SELECT
id, name, permalink, nb_images, global_rank,
date_last, max_date_last, count_images, count_categories
FROM phpwg_categories INNER JOIN phpwg_user_cache_categories
ON id = cat_id and user_id = 1
WHERE
1 = 1
; in /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/functions.inc.php on line 918
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/functions_category.inc.php on line 103
Warning: [mysql error 1052] Column 'date_last' in field list is ambiguous
SELECT
c.*, nb_images, date_last, max_date_last, count_images, count_categories
FROM phpwg_categories c INNER JOIN phpwg_user_cache_categories
ON id = cat_id and user_id = 1
WHERE id_uppercat is NULL
ORDER BY rank
; in /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/functions.inc.php on line 918
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/category_cats.inc.php on line 78
Warning: Cannot modify header information - headers already sent by (output started at /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/functions.inc.php:917) in /mnt/114/free.fr/c/9/pieroprod/piwigo-2.0.4/include/page_header.php on line 98
phpMyVisites
Il y a une incohérence sur ce champ ...
Je n'ai pas non plus le treeview qui s'affiche.
Je nage ...
Et, pourtant, ça a fonctionné à un moment. Cela peut-il avoir un rapport avec des plugins ?
Merci de vous pencher sur mon cas ...
PS : j'ai été obligé d'installer le plugin pour les langues car les textes ne restaient pas tous traduits, voire pas traduits du tout et le norvégien, c'est pas mon fort ! ;)
Dernière modification par napi (2009-09-29 22:07:52)
Hors ligne
Cela pourrait arriver aux utilisateurs qui "bidouillent" et qui ont réussi à rater leur migration.
la colonne `date_last`est une colonne de la table #_user_cache_categories
comme tout un chacun peut le vérifier dans la 2.0.4
la colonne `date_last`N'est PAS une colonne de la table #_categories
comme tout un chacun peut le vérifier dans la 2.0.4
Évidement si tu as bidouillé et que la colonne date_last figure dans la table #_categories
Warning: [mysql error 1052] Column 'date_last' in field list is ambiguous
Il est normal que l'origine de la donnée à récupérer soit pour le moins ambigüe mais ne ne modifierons pas le code de Piwigo pour autant.
Tu devrais savoir ce qu'il te reste à faire.
Je te conseille si tu as une sauvegarde récente de la version précédente de ta galerie, c'est de la restaurer.
Et de suivre à la lettre la procédure de Mise à jour
d'éventuellement de poser la bonne question en cas de message anormal de la migration.
Mais le mode pompier aux personnes qui bidouillent, je n'aime pas beaucoup.
En espérant que cela t'aide.
Hors ligne
Je suis désolé pour ces complications ...
J'ai supprimé le champ en trop et je n'ai plus de message.
Par contre, je n'ai toujours pas le treeview avec les catégories ... je ne pense pas que cela ait un rapport ...
Merci pour ton intervention ;)
Hors ligne
Tu as raté ta migration...
Soit tu la recommences si tu peux.
Soit tu passes les contrôles d'intégrité et on t'aidera à réparer mais au final, je ne te donnerai pas avec certitude que tout sera correct.
Hors ligne
Merci d'avoir répondu ...
J'ai passé tous les outils de maintenance, ce qui m'a permis de voir qu'il y avait aussi le champ nb_images qui avait changé de table.
J'ai donc remis ce champ vide et ai repassé les outils de maintenance ...
Et, oh, miracle, ça a l'air de fonctionner !
Encore désolé pour le tracas ... ;)
Hors ligne
C'est toi qui aurais dû te tracasser...
De notre côté, nos galeries fonctionnent.
C'est presque des pendules astronomiques, et déjà, nous savons où sont les boulons à resserrer si besoin.
(historique, sessions, search par exemple).
;-))
Hors ligne
napi a écrit:
Par contre, étant chez free, je pense que je ne devrais pas être tout seul à foirer une migration ;)
Il y a aussi des migrations qui fonctionne chez free. J'ai fait toutes les évolution depuis la 1.7.0 jusqu'à la 2.0.4 sur 6 sites sans problème ;-)
Hors ligne
napi a écrit:
Je ne saurai donc jamais pourquoi ça a foiré de manière identique sur mes 2 galeries ...
Une personnalisation identique sur les 2 ?
La même étape du guide passé trop vite ?
Hors ligne
napi a écrit:
Je ne saurai donc jamais pourquoi ça a foiré de manière identique sur mes 2 galeries ...
Parce que tu es informaticien, et entre ce que tu sais, ce que tu comprends, ce que tu veux comprendre, ce que tu admets, et ce que tu fais au bout du compte cela n'a rien à voir.
Hors ligne
ddtddt a écrit:
Une personnalisation identique sur les 2 ?
La même étape du guide passé trop vite ?
Non, le même problème à la migration de la base ...
VDigital a écrit:
Parce que tu es informaticien, et entre ce que tu sais, ce que tu comprends, ce que tu veux comprendre, ce que tu admets, et ce que tu fais au bout du compte cela n'a rien à voir.
Je l'ai pas loin, ce panneau ...
Hors ligne